Basic Barbecue Rub

This is a great barbecue rub that works well with just about any cut of meat. 


1/4 Cup coarse salt (kosher or sea)
1/4 Cup brown sugar (preferably dark, but light is OK too)
1/4 Cup paprika
2 Tablespoons freshly ground black pepper


Put all the ingredients in a bowl and mix them together very well. Your fingers actually work better than a spoon or whisk. Or you can put everything in a jar and shake it. If you do this, you will probably have to stop and open it to crush some chunks of brown sugar since it likes to clump together.


Store the rub in an airtight container away from heat and light. It will keep for a good 6 months.
